Cracked kdx220 stock piston

(Click here to view the original thread with full colors/images)


Posted by: outrgus---------------------

Took my top end apart yesterday and found that my stock piston was cracked on the intake side I have less than 500 km on this new top end, so i would suggest to any one with any mods (pipe, reeds, etc) to be carefull. I know this has been posted before but i thought you could never have too many warnings. Just for your info i have used the stock piston before with the stock pipe and never had any problem until i upgraded my pipe and reeds. Glad i check my top end often, will have a wesico piston in it tommorow.



Posted by: trsrdr---------------------

I've been told by a reliable source that after the '97 model year bikes, it's good practice to replace the piston immediately due to piston failure.



Posted by: est142---------------------

definately. my 97 220 still has the original piston. there was a design change (for the worse apparently) for 98 and later kdx 220s. i would pull the piston in favor of a wiseco. i will probably do my own next winter.
